Backed by an international team, strong funding, and a bold vision, we’re looking for people who want to shape the next generation of aerial security and build something that truly matters. 🎯 How you will make an impact: Design, optimize, and operate RF communication links for airborne and ground segments (C2, telemetry, payload data), including deconfliction and EW scenarios. Own end-to-end link budgets and performance analysis (EIRP, SNR, Losses Eb/Eno) Integrate and maintain RF communication links into existing IP networks to enable transparent operation with high quality of service(QOS). Define and integrate RF modules for passive RF-based detection and localization of drones. Support antenna/RF integration on airborne platforms (placement, cabling, radome effects, isolation, EMC considerations). Drive the company’s RF engineering abilities, perform end-to-end tests in the laboratory, and on our field test sites. ✅ What you need to be successful: Solid fundamentals in RF, wireless communication, and the OSI model. Practical experience in delivering high-performance real-world wireless communication applications, including link budget management and modeling. Experience with design and integration of radio location systems. Hands-on debugging mindset with common RF lab tools (spectrum analyzer/VSA, VNA, power meter, etc.). Practical experience in EMC/EMI, ideally in a military context. Ideally, knowledge in Python to automate analysis and configuration tasks. Proactive and organized team player.
